On March 31, Brass Companys March absorption costing accounting system contained the following information. Assume per units costs for February were the same as the March per unit costs.
Units sold | 82,000 |
Units Produced | 80,000 |
Sales Price | $40.00 |
Total Cost of Goods Manufactured | $1,600,000 |
Total Selling & Admin. Expenses | $100,000 |
Units in Ending Inventory | 1,000 |
Fixed Manufacturing Costs | $200,000 |
Fixed Selling & Admin. Expenses | $60,000 |
Required:
- Determine the March Ending Inventory balance using absorption costing (Show your work).
- Determine the March Beginning Inventory balance using absorption costing (Show your work).
- Determine the Ending Inventory balance using variable costing (Show your work).
- Determine the March Beginning Inventory balance using variable costing (Show your work).
- Prepare an Absorption Costing Income Statement down to the Operating Income level.
- Prepare a Variable Costing Income Statement down to the Operating Income level.
- Show how the difference in the operating incomes in (C) and (D) occurred. In other words, show me how you would reconcile the difference.
